ADRON will continue to play with the team as a stand-in after a faulty logic caused the VRS to list an incomplete Nexus core for two months. ![]() Laurențiu "lauNX" Țârlea has been added to Nexus' roster, returning to the organization he represented for a year in 2021-2022, the Romanian side announced on Monday. The 19-year-old, who previously plied his trade in a brief Revenant stint, has taken Roberto "ADRON" Paun's place on the roster. ADRON will continue to play with the team as a stand-in, however, as lauNX is unable to join the team for their ongoing tournaments due to a situation the organization described as an "error on their VRS lineup." This is because Valve's ranking mechanism listed an outdated Nexus core for the first two months of the year. One of their core players, Cosmin "ragga" Teodorescu, sat out the team's last match of 2024, and the stand-in, Gabriel-Cosmin "zewts" Letcanu, was included on the VRS instead of ragga. Nexus then made a player change at the beginning of January, replacing Daniel-Cătălin "Ciocardau" Purice with Alexandru "s0und" Ștefan, but had no way of updating the lineup until February after a CCT event they were invited to in January had its ranked status pulled. Because ADRON, Cătălin-Ionuț "BTN" Stănescu and Adrian "XELLOW" Guță formed the three-man core according to the VRS, Nexus cannot play any tournaments they've been invited to based on the January or February invitation rankings without one of those three players. March 3 is the first relevant VRS that once again features ragga as well as new addition s0und, which will make the PGL Astana Europe closed qualifier the first tournament Nexus will be able to play with lauNX.
